In preparing categorical variables for analysis, it is usually best to

a. convert the categories to numeric representations.
b. convert the categories to binary, dummy variables.
c. combine as many categories as possible.
d. let them remain categorical.


b
RATIONALE: Typically, it is best to encode categorical variables with 0-1 dummy variables. Using 0-1 dummy variables to encode categorical variables with many different categories results in a large number of variables. In some cases, the number of categories may be reduced by combining categories.
